BATMAN (1989) - Costume Fabric Sample Book
A costume fabric sample book from the production of Tim Burton's superhero film Batman. Fabric books are used to catalogue the materials used to create a film's costumes, and provide a unique reference to the costume design and manufacturing process.

This fabric book is contained in a blue plastic ring binder with "Batman Fabric Book, Bob Ringwood" written on the front in black permanent marker pen. Ringwood is an Academy Award-nominated costume designer. The fabric swatches and notes in this collection focus on the film's criminal characters: the Joker (Jack Nicholson), Rotelli (Edwin Craig), Grissom (Jack Palance) and their supporting cast of goons and thugs. It is full of scraps of fabric and ideas for costume design, with detailed creative notes handwritten alongside.

Included in the book are numerous purple-and -green checked fabric samples €” part of the design process behind the Joker's trousers €” as well as lilac leather, which was considered for the Joker's gloves and spats. There is also a range of monochrome fabrics for the seven mime goon characters. The binder contains 50 clear plastic pockets, 17 of which contain items or pages, with some loose items too. Many of the pages have been creased or feature small tears. There is some ink transfer on the inside of the binder and some scuffing on the outside. Dimensions: 32 cm x 29 cm x 8 cm (12 1/2" x 11 3/4" x 3 1/4")
